I was out and about last Friday on my way to JuJu Spa for a mid-day pick me up service. I ended up arriving in Queen Village way ahead of schedule and decided just to walk around for a bit. Best decision I made all week! I stumbled upon the BEST vintage store.. Astro Vintage.

From the moment you step inside this ADORABLE boutique you are immediately greeted by the sweetest woman, Karin, the owner. Karin has the warmest personality… the kind where you want to talk with her over a long cup of coffee and discuss everything from fashion to travel to food. Her style is a blend of her two favorite decades 1940′s and 1950′s, full of personality with feminine touches – the result is one amazing outfit. Her store has plenty of character as well – a robin blue color covers the walls, perfectly spaced clothing hangs neatly, home decor intermixed with clothes and outwear, and a massive jewelery case holding some of the best gems!

My weakness is jewelry…I have a major addiction, I will admit it. I usually try and find pieces that make me want to know the story behind them or get them because they have a connection/memory for me. So I added to my collection of everyday pieces while at Astro Vintage! I got lost in the case and fell in love with two beautiful rings! The rings combined totaled $52…you just cannot beat that!

My beautiful new rings!!
Therefore I want the world to know that if you are looking for unique, beautiful, and inexpensive finds – go to Astro Vintage! The jewelry ranges in price from $10-$50. Stop by anytime (except Tuesday, the only day they are closed) 702 S. 5th Street, Philadelphia, PA 19147 and explore the racks and shelves for some amazing and inexpensive items!

It’s that time again, when Red Balloon Public Relations grows our family of great businesses run by fantastic people. The latest addition to our team is Dollface Studio. This is by far one the most original photography studios to make their mark in Philadelphia. Dollface specializes in Boudoir style photography. Think beautiful women dolled up in flawless makeup, dripping with pearls and ultra feminine lingerie.
Darah and Siobhan, co-owners of DollFace Studio created Dollface Boudoir as an outlet for women to showcase how sexy and glamorous they are in their own skin and they make it so easy to celebrate the beautiful woman inside of each of their subjects. Women walk out of their studio with an extra jolt of confidence, whether the photos are for their eyes only, or to gift to the husb.
